Novak Djokovic Triumphs Over Germany’s Koepfer to Reach Paris Olympics Quarterfinals

"Novak Djokovic Overcomes Koepfer to Secure Quarterfinal Spot, Faces Tsitsipas Next"

The Serbian top seed, who previously defeated Rafael Nadal, secured a 7-5, 6-3 win and will now face world number 11 Stefanos Tsitsipas in the quarterfinals.

Djokovic Advances to Olympic Quarterfinals

Novak Djokovic’s journey to his first Olympic gold medal continues as he overcame German left-hander Dominik Koepfer with a 7-5, 6-3 victory. This achievement makes Djokovic the first man to reach four Olympic singles quarterfinals. Despite the challenging humid conditions, Djokovic displayed his resilience and superior skill against the 70th-ranked Koepfer.

Next Challenge: Stefanos Tsitsipas

Djokovic’s next opponent is Greece’s Stefanos Tsitsipas, currently ranked 11th in the world. The two players have faced off before, most notably in the 2021 French Open final where Djokovic emerged victorious. This upcoming quarterfinal match is highly anticipated as both players aim to advance to the semifinals.

Nadal and Alcaraz Pursue Doubles Glory

Rafael Nadal and Carlos Alcaraz are targeting a place in the men’s doubles semifinals. Nadal, a 14-time French Open singles champion, is seeking his third Olympic gold medal. The Spanish pair will compete against fourth seeds Austin Krajicek and Rajeev Ram of the United States, who both boast impressive Grand Slam achievements.

Other Key Quarterfinal Matches

Alexander Zverev vs. Alexei Popyrin

Defending champion and third-seeded Alexander Zverev of Germany will face Australia’s Alexei Popyrin in what promises to be an exciting clash.

Daniil Medvedev vs. Felix Auger-Aliassime

Fourth-seeded Daniil Medvedev, competing as a neutral athlete, is set to take on Canada’s Felix Auger-Aliassime.

Iga Swiatek’s Quest for Gold

Iga Swiatek, the four-time French Open champion, is aiming for her 25th consecutive win at Roland Garros. She will play against Danielle Collins of the United States in the women’s quarterfinals. Swiatek’s path to a gold medal has been somewhat eased following the elimination of world number two Coco Gauff.

Angelique Kerber vs. Zheng Qinwen

Three-time major champion Angelique Kerber, who plans to retire after the Olympics, will face China’s Zheng Qinwen. Zheng advanced to the quarterfinals after a tough match against Emma Navarro.

Barbora Krejcikova vs. Anna Karolina Schmiedlova

Wimbledon champion Barbora Krejcikova will compete against Anna Karolina Schmiedlova, who surprised many by defeating French Open and Wimbledon runner-up Jasmine Paolini.

Marta Kostyuk vs. Donna Vekic

In the last of the women’s quarterfinals, Ukraine’s Marta Kostyuk will face Wimbledon semifinalist Donna Vekic of Croatia.
